Webエンジニア向けプログラミング解説動画をYouTubeで配信中!
▶ チャンネル登録はこちら

【ITニュース解説】6 Must-Have Non-Google Android Apps to Supercharge Your Productivity

2025年09月17日に「Medium」が公開したITニュース「6 Must-Have Non-Google Android Apps to Supercharge Your Productivity」について初心者にもわかりやすく解説しています。

作成日: 更新日:

ITニュース概要

Androidデバイスの生産性を高める、Google製ではないアプリが6つ紹介されている。現代社会で効率的に作業を進め、日々のタスクをより効果的にこなすための有用な情報がまとめられている。

ITニュース解説

現代社会では、単に多くの時間を費やして忙しくすることだけが生産的であると見なされる時代は終わり、いかに効率良く、より少ない労力で質の高い成果を出すかが重要視されている。特に情報技術の分野で活躍するシステムエンジニアにとって、日々の複雑なタスクをこなしながら新しい知識を習得し、複数のプロジェクトを円滑に進めるためには、個人の生産性を最大限に高める工夫が不可欠となる。多くのAndroidユーザーはGoogleが提供する便利なアプリ群に慣れ親しんでいるが、市場にはGoogle以外の開発者たちが提供する、優れた機能とユニークな視点を持ったアプリが数多く存在する。これらは特定のニーズに特化したり、プライバシー保護に重きを置いたりすることで、ユーザーに新たな選択肢を提供し、日々の作業効率を飛躍的に向上させる可能性を秘めている。

システムエンジニアの作業効率を高める上で特に注目すべき非Google製Androidアプリには、以下の6つのカテゴリが挙げられる。

一つ目は、タスク・プロジェクト管理アプリである。システム開発では、一つの大きな目標が多数の小さなタスクに分解され、それぞれに担当者や期限が設定される。このような複雑なタスク群を効率的に管理し、進捗を可視化するためのアプリは、個人の生産性向上だけでなく、チーム全体の協調性にも大きく貢献する。非Google系のアプリの中には、より柔軟なカスタマイズ性や、カンバン方式、ガントチャートといった多様な表示形式に対応し、大規模なプロジェクト管理にも耐えうる機能を備えたものが多い。例えば、タスクの親子関係を設定したり、依存関係を明確にしたりすることで、作業のボトルネックを発見しやすくなる。また、他のメンバーとのタスク共有やコメント機能を通じて、進捗状況の報告や課題解決のための連携がスムーズに行えるようになるため、システムエンジニアは自身の担当するコーディングやテスト作業に集中しつつも、プロジェクト全体の中での位置づけを常に把握できる。

二つ目は、高機能メモ・ノートアプリだ。プログラミングのアイデア、技術的な調査結果、会議の議事録、学習内容の記録など、システムエンジニアは日々膨大な情報を処理し、整理する必要がある。標準のメモアプリでは機能が不足することが多いが、非Google系のノートアプリの中には、マークダウン記法に対応し、コードスニペットを綺麗に整形して保存できるものや、画像や添付ファイルを簡単に挿入できるもの、タグ付けやフォルダ分けによる高度な整理機能を備えたものが存在する。さらに、手書きメモや音声入力に対応することで、思考のスピードに合わせて柔軟に情報を記録できる利点もある。これらのアプリを活用することで、散漫になりがちな情報を一箇所に集約し、後から必要な情報を素早く検索・参照することが可能となる。

三つ目は、スケジュール・時間管理アプリだ。プロジェクトの締め切り、定例会議、障害対応、個人の学習時間など、システムエンジニアは常に複数のスケジュールと向き合っている。標準のカレンダーアプリでも基本的な機能は提供されるが、非Google系のアプリには、より直感的なUIでスケジュールを素早く入力・確認できるものや、特定の時間帯をブロックして集中作業時間を確保する機能、タスクとカレンダーを連携させて進捗を管理できるものなどがある。また、時間帯による通知設定の細かさや、Googleカレンダー以外の様々なカレンダーサービスとの同期機能を持つアプリも多く、複数のプラットフォームを跨いでスケジュールを一元管理したい場合に非常に役立つ。これにより、自分の時間配分を最適化し、重要なタスクへの集中力を高めることができる。

四つ目は、ファイル共有・クラウドストレージアプリである。システム開発では、コードファイル、設計書、テストデータ、ログファイルなど、多種多様なファイルをチームメンバーと共有したり、複数のデバイスからアクセスしたりする必要がある。Googleドライブも一般的だが、非Google系のクラウドストレージサービスやそれに連携するアプリには、より高度なセキュリティ機能を提供するものや、特定の種類のファイルに特化した管理機能を持つもの、オープンソースで透明性の高い運用をされているものも存在する。これらを利用することで、大容量のファイルを安全かつ迅速に共有し、デバイス間の同期を保ちながら、いつでもどこでも必要な情報にアクセスできるようになる。バージョン管理システムとの連携機能を持つアプリも存在し、開発プロセスにおけるファイルの管理をより効率的に行えるようになる。

五つ目は、コミュニケーション・コラボレーションアプリだ。システム開発はチームで行うことがほとんどであり、メンバー間の密なコミュニケーションと情報共有がプロジェクト成功の鍵を握る。チャットツール、ビデオ会議システム、共同編集可能なドキュメントツールなど、多岐にわたるアプリが非Google系からも提供されている。これらのアプリは、リアルタイムでの質疑応答、課題の共有、技術的なディスカッション、コードレビューといった開発における様々なコミュニケーションを円滑にする。特に、特定の開発ワークフローに特化した機能を持つものや、セキュリティポリシーが厳格な企業向けのソリューションを提供するものなどがあり、チームの特性やプロジェクトの要件に合わせて最適なツールを選択できる。これにより、情報伝達のロスを減らし、チーム全体の生産性を向上させることが可能となる。

六つ目は、集中力向上・習慣化アプリだ。プログラミングや設計作業は高い集中力を要するが、現代社会にはスマートフォンからの通知やウェブサイトの誘惑など、集中を妨げる要素が数多く存在する。非Google系のアプリには、特定の時間だけ通知をオフにしたり、特定のアプリの使用を制限したりすることで、作業に集中できる環境を意図的に作り出すものがある。また、ポモドーロテクニックのような時間管理手法を取り入れたり、目標達成に向けた小さな習慣を追跡したりする機能を持つアプリもあり、これらを活用することで、集中力を維持し、効率的に作業を進める習慣を身につけることができる。

これらの非Google製アプリを選ぶ最大のメリットは、Googleのエコシステムに縛られない多様な選択肢が得られる点にある。プライバシー保護を重視するアプリ、特定のニッチな機能に特化したアプリ、オープンソースでコミュニティによって開発されているアプリなど、自身の価値観や具体的なニーズに合わせて最適なツールを見つけることができる。また、Googleのサービスに障害が発生した場合でも、代替手段を確保しておくことで、作業が完全に滞るリスクを軽減できる。

システムエンジニアを目指す者にとって、これらの生産性向上アプリは単なる補助ツールではない。これらは情報管理のスキル、時間管理の習慣、チーム連携能力、そして何よりも自身のキャリアを「スーパーチャージ」するための強力な武器となる。自分に合ったアプリを見つけ、それを日々の作業フローに組み込むことで、より効率的で、より質の高い成果を生み出し、エンジニアとしての成長を加速させることができるだろう。最終的には、自分自身の仕事のスタイルやプロジェクトの特性を理解し、最適なツールを賢く選択する能力が、これからのエンジニアには求められる。

関連コンテンツ

関連IT用語

【ITニュース解説】6 Must-Have Non-Google Android Apps to Supercharge Your Productivity | いっしー@Webエンジニア